Our Earthline collection includes a variety of Gemstones, each rich with meaning & connection. We have:
Tiger’s Eye
A stone of courage and protection, Tiger’s Eye is believed to bring confidence, grounding energy and the strength to move forward with clarity.
Peach Moonstone
Peach Moonstone carries a soft, nurturing energy associated with intuition, emotional balance and the gentle power of feminine strength.
African Turquoise
Often called the Stone of Evolution, African Turquoise is believed to inspire growth, positive change and the courage to embrace new paths.
Pearls
Long associated with wisdom and calm, Pearls symbolise purity, emotional balance and the quiet strength that comes from within.
Unakite
Unakite is known as a stone of harmony, believed to support emotional healing, balance the heart and encourage gentle personal growth.
Sodalite
A stone of truth and clarity, Sodalite is thought to encourage honest expression, intuition and calm, rational thinking.
Labradorite
Labradorite is often called the stone of transformation, believed to spark creativity, strengthen intuition and protect your energy.
